Transaction f716800445a91e6ec38406b5a8242d21b1c20ec90d39d6975ff3da5705ccd8ec
1 Input
2 Outputs
- f716800445a91e6ec38406b5a8242d21b1c20ec90d39d6975ff3da5705ccd8ec:0
- f716800445a91e6ec38406b5a8242d21b1c20ec90d39d6975ff3da5705ccd8ec:1
value 30780899
address 1A2oMr4FEta1WwkoAquApeLmeeeKKR8zNn
value 67062504
address 16MD7eJDFAkjSHZySCrKsydwh5wcogqivR